Cambridge Security Seals Increases Production Capacity to Reduce Lead Times

Tamper-evident seal manufacturer expands its physical footprint to enhance service to cargo, logistics, and supply chain industries.

Cambridge Security Seals (CSS), a global provider of tamper-evident seals and asset protection products, has expanded its manufacturing capacity as part of its effort to combat the trend of growing turnaround times for custom products within the industry.

As a key part of Phase II of the New York-based company’s multiyear expansion plan, this enhancement includes expanding the physical footprint of its facilities by more than 25% to accommodate the addition of several new high-speed automated production lines that will increase production capacity by more than 25%.
